Moscow has long been a centre of Russian and world culture. The Bolshoi Theatre presents operas and ballets. The Bolshoi Ballet has become internationally known and admired. Dancers from all over the country are trained at the Bolshoi Theatres school.
The Moscow State Symphony and other orchestras perform at the Tchaikovsky Concert Hall in Moscow. The city also features a number of famous drama theatres, including the Maly and Moscow Art theatres.
Moscow has about 75 museums and many art galleries. The State Historical Museum attracts many students of Russian history. The Central Museum of the Revolution has exhibits on the Russian Revolution. Dazzling treasures that belonged to the czars are displayed in the Armoury Museum in the Kremlin.
The Tretyakov Gallery contains a collection of traditional art. The Russian National Exhibition Centre highlights science and technology.
Over 1,200 main libraries operate in Moscow. The Russian State Library is the largest library in Russia, and it ranks as one of the largest libraries in the world.

Москва долгое время является центром российской и мировой культуры. Большой театр показывает оперы и балеты. Балет Большого театра стал всемирно известным и признанным. Балерины из всех уголков страны обучаются в школе Большого театра.
Московский государственный симфонический и другие оркестры выступают в концертном зале им. Чайковского в Москве. Город также характеризуется наличием многих известных драматических театров, включая Малый и Московский Художественный театры.
В Москве есть приблизительно 75 музеев и много художественных галерей. Государственный исторический музей привлекает многих студентов, изучающих российскую историю.
В Центральном музее Революции есть выставки о российской Революции. Ослепительные сокровища, которые принадлежали царям, выставлены в музее оружия в Кремле.
Третьяковская Галерея располагает коллекцией традиционного искусства. Российский Национальный Выставочный Центр представляет достижения науки и техники.
Более 1200 главных библиотек действуют в Москве. Российская государственная библиотека — наибольшая библиотека в России, и она считается одной из наибольших библиотек в мире.
